Understanding the Importance of Inventory Management Software

Effective inventory management is paramount for any small business, regardless of industry. Poor inventory control can lead to lost sales, increased storage costs, and even financial instability. Inventory system software helps businesses avoid these pitfalls by providing a centralized system for tracking and managing all aspects of inventory.

Key Benefits of Inventory Management Software

  • Reduced Stockouts and Overstocking: Real-time data helps predict demand and optimize reorder points, minimizing stockouts and costly overstocking.
  • Improved Accuracy: Automated tracking minimizes human error, ensuring accurate inventory counts and preventing discrepancies.
  • Enhanced Efficiency: Streamlined processes for receiving, storing, and shipping goods free up valuable time for other business functions.
  • Better Cost Control: Provides insights into inventory costs, helping businesses make informed decisions about pricing and purchasing.
  • Improved Data Analysis: Generates reports and analytics that provide valuable insights into sales trends, customer behavior, and inventory performance.

Types of Inventory System Software for Small Businesses

Several types of inventory management software cater to different needs and budgets. Understanding the options is crucial for selecting the right solution.

Cloud-Based Inventory Systems

Cloud-based systems offer accessibility from anywhere with an internet connection. They are often scalable and affordable, making them a popular choice for small businesses. Consider factors like user interface, integration capabilities, and vendor support when evaluating cloud-based solutions.

On-Premise Inventory Systems, Inventory system software for small business

On-premise systems require installation and maintenance on company servers. While potentially more customized, they often come with higher upfront costs and require IT expertise. Weigh the cost and complexity against potential benefits for your specific needs.

Choosing the Right Inventory System for Your Small Business

Choosing the right inventory system involves careful consideration of several factors. Consider your business’s specific needs, budget, and technical expertise when making your selection.

Factors to Consider

  • Scalability: The system should be able to grow with your business.
  • Integration: Look for systems that integrate with your existing accounting software and point-of-sale (POS) systems.
  • User-Friendliness: A user-friendly interface ensures your team can quickly adapt and use the system effectively.
  • Budget: Determine a budget and evaluate systems that fit within your financial constraints.

Inventory Management Software Features to Look For

Essential features to consider include real-time inventory tracking, automated order management, reporting and analytics capabilities, and integration with other business systems. Don’t overlook features such as barcode scanning, inventory forecasting, and customer relationship management (CRM) integration.
